I'm going to make the assumption I found some sort of software bug with the latest firmware for the RBR850/RBS850.
I was able to return it to the vendor and instead I purchased the Orbi Pro SXR80/SXS80's, etc
Exact same setup 1 router and 3 satellites and it looks like the Ethernet backhaul is working right.
I was able to configure it by finding the IP address and going to it from my PC. After it was all setup, I can see the router reporting under Attached Devices that 3 Satellites are connected, and when I go to Attached Devices I can see the 3 satellites are listed as wired.
This is a sigh of relief as I never saw any of this in the web pages of the Orbi RBR850/RBS850's, so I'm definitely much happier, just have to figure out why my iPhone and Android versions of the Orbi app won't connect to it.
